DEC Alpha AXP Pci33 motherboard with CPU.

Supports ARC and SRM console.

Clock speed from 66 to 300 Mhz. 

Supports 21068 or 21068 CPU's.

Includes 166 MHz 21066 CPU.

0K cache - uses regular DIP 32x8 or 128x8 SRAM for max of 1 MB.

5 ISA and 3 PCI slots (one shared).

Uses regular PC power supply (note: the power supply supplies

5V to PCI slots, if you are using a PCI card that requires 3V,

you'll need 3/5V power supply).

Regular baby-AT layout - uses regular PC case.

Includes on board: SCSI-2, IDE, floppy, 2 serial/1 par ports.

Comes with a well-written manual for OEM builder.

Uses regular parity (x36) SIMMs.

Two type of boards available - one with AT keyboard connector,

one with PS keyboard and mouse.

As an example (this is just an example, I do not offer this parts

for sale), I built a complete Alpha machine for under $500:



Case/PS: $30

M/B $129

Cache (256K) $10

520 MB HD (SCSI) $80

CDROM (SCSI 2x) $30

Cable (SCSI) $10

Memory (24 MB) $80

K/B, mouse $12

ISA video card (1 MB) $20

Floppy drive (1.44, you can use 2.88 also) $20



I used ISA video card because the PCI card I had did not work (probably

required 3V). In any case, the result was a nice upgradable Alpha

machine with built-in CD-ROM, external SCSI, etc., for around $450.

Plus monitor, of-course. You can also re-use some o these old 

components in your closet, of-course. Windows NT loaded on a first try.

Not a bad deal at all..
